Odor Elimination Power

How do you make sure lingering odors don’t bounce back after cleaning? Choose a powdered carpet cleaner with active enzymes or natural odor-neutralizing agents that break down organic residues at the source. Look for absorbent bases like baking soda or plant-based powders-they trap and lock in smells during the 15–30 minute dwell time. That longer wait isn’t wasted; it lets the powder pull odors up from deep in the fibers. Opt for low-moisture or dry formulas, since they avoid dampness that leads to microbial growth and musty smells. You’ll also want sustained-release fragrances that keep carpets smelling fresh for days, not just minutes. Testers noticed formulas with enzyme blends cut pet and food odors best, while baking soda-based powders handled smoke and spills with ease. Real performance comes from smart chemistry, not just scent cover-up. Trust science, not perfume.

Surface Compatibility

A powdered carpet cleaner that works across various surfaces guarantees you’re not stuck buying multiple products for different areas of your home. You’ll want one safe for delicate natural fibers like wool and silk, since harsh formulas can cause fading or weakening over time. Make sure it’s also compatible with synthetic carpets-nylon and polyester, in particular-so you avoid residue buildup that attracts dirt. If you’re cleaning upholstery or furniture fabrics, pick a powder labeled for use on code S-rated or textured materials to prevent damage. Confirm it’s tough enough for area rugs and high-traffic zones, where repeated cleanings are normal. Choose a non-corrosive, residue-free formula so it won’t break down carpet backing or settle into grout lines, especially on low-pile or textured floors.

Safety For Pets

When pets roam your home, choosing a powdered carpet cleaner means prioritizing formulas that won’t put their health at risk. You’ll want non-toxic powders free from ammonia, bleach, and phthalates-common irritants that can harm curious paws or noses. Skip synthetic fragrances and dyes, which may trigger sensitivities in animals with sharp scent detection. Instead, pick plant-based or baking soda–powered options that neutralize odors naturally, without leaving toxic residues. Avoid essential oils, especially in homes with cats or dogs prone to respiratory issues-they can cause irritation even in small amounts. Make sure the cleaner is safe for frequent use and fully breaks down, so your pet won’t ingest harmful traces while grooming. A truly pet-safe powder cleans deeply, works fast, and protects your furry family without compromise.

Ease Of Application

Choosing a pet-safe formula sets the foundation for a healthier home, but you’ll also want a powdered carpet cleaner that’s simple and efficient to use. You just sprinkle the powder evenly across the carpet, let it sit 15 to 30 minutes, and let it pull up odors and grime. For better results, gently work it in with a soft-bristled brush-this helps the powder reach deep into fibers. Some formulas work even better when you pre-mist the carpet lightly, activating their cleaning power before you apply. Vacuum thoroughly after treatment, making multiple passes to lift all residue. Because it’s a dry formula, you won’t deal with soggy carpets or long waits-foot traffic can resume immediately. Users report clean, refreshed rugs without sticky leftovers, especially when following the full cycle: sprinkle, wait, brush, vacuum. It’s straightforward, no special tools needed, and works fast.

Cleaning Mechanism

A quality powdered carpet cleaner works by combining advanced dry-cleaning technology with targeted stain and odor removal, so you don’t need water to see real results. You simply sprinkle the powder, and its absorbent particles act like micro-sponges, pulling dirt, oils, and moisture from deep in fibers. If you’re tackling pet accidents or food spills, choose formulas with natural enzymes-they break down organic residues at the molecular level for stronger odor elimination. These low-moisture treatments prevent over-saturation, protecting carpet backing and reducing mold risk. Deodorizing ingredients like baking soda trap and neutralize odors, not mask them. For best results, let the powder dwell undisturbed 30–60 minutes before vacuuming thoroughly. Testers say visible soil lifts quickly, with high-traffic areas showing noticeable improvement after one use. Effectiveness hinges on contact time and proper coverage, so follow label directions closely for deep, lasting clean.

Can Powdered Carpet Cleaners Be Used on Upholstery?

You can use powdered carpet cleaners on upholstery, but only if the product label specifies it’s safe for fabric furniture. Always check for colorfastness first, sprinkle lightly, then work it in with a soft brush. Let it sit for 15–20 minutes before vacuuming thoroughly. Avoid over-application, as residue attracts dirt. Spot-test on hidden areas to guarantee no staining or fabric damage occurs during cleaning.
